Hitopdesh • Chapter 3 • Shloka 59
करटको ब्रूते -- अथ तत्र गत्वा किं वक्ष्यति भवान् । स आह -- शृणु । किमनुरक्तो विरक्तो वा मयि स्वामीति ज्ञास्यामि तावत् । करटको ब्रूते -- किं तज्ज्ञानलक्षणम् । दमनको ब्रूते -- शृणु । दूराद् अवेक्षणं हासः संप्रश्नेष्वादरो भृशम् । परोक्षेऽपि गुणश्लाघा स्मरणं प्रियवस्तुषु ॥
Karataka said - Now going there what will you say? He said - Hear me. In the first place I will ascertain whether the master is attached to me or not. Karataka asked - What is the sign from which this can be known? Damanaka replied - Listen. Looking (at one) from a distance, smiling, great regard for inquiries about one's welfare, praising the merits even in one's absence: remembering one among objects which are dear.
